Usable tire sizes for 3 on stock rims
 
I live in West Michigan and we get snow, sloppy wet snow. The stock Goodyear tires suck so I want something better for winter that aren't snow tires, so all season.

I know the stock tires are 205/50 R17 but what other sizes will fit without problems?

Discount Tire says the 215/50 R17 and 215/55 R17 will fit without problems. That true?

For tires I was looking at the Yokohama AVID TRZ and the Kumho ECSTA ASX. The Cooper Lifeliner SLE H/V also look good.

Any advice?

Olestra January-22nd-2007 07:11 PM

Yes that's true.
Taller and skinnier is better in snow but worse for handling.
